Here’s How to Protect Yourself!

Water is one of the most powerful forces on earth, and it is also one of the most common reasons that people have to renovate their homes. Whether it comes to you through flooding or leaks, water can do untold damage to a home. And because water spreads fast and leads to mold and other problems, it’s important that you make repairs right away.

Flooding

Flooding is an all too common reason that people have to renovate their homes. Overflowing rivers or big storms with lots of rainfall can cause flooding even in areas that aren’t normally prone to flooding. The truth is that it doesn’t matter how much water makes it into your house, even a little bit of flooding will require serious work.

When water enters a house, it can bring with it a host of other things, including bacteria, sewage and mud. Water spreads fast throughout a house and can be absorbed by drywall, carpet and other flooring materials. It’s important to remember that flood damage is different from regular water damage. Make sure that you have the right type of insurance so that you can renovate your house after flood damage.

Water Damage


Water damage comes from many sources, including rainstorms and snow. There are more reasons to repair a damaged roof than just water damage, but water damage is a huge reason why you may need to take on an unexpected renovation project. Most roofs aren’t completely waterproof, and that means that melting snow or rain can weaken your roofing, and water can eventually make its way into your attic or walls. If you’re not inspecting your roof regularly, then you could be in for some extensive renovations.

Water Leaks

Water leaks of all kinds can create the need for major home renovations. Anything from a leaking washing machine to a leaking pipe can damage large areas of your home. As stated above, water spreads quickly; one small leak in a pipe located in your bathroom wall, and you might find that you have to completely redo the drywall, tile, paint and flooring. Once you discover a leak, calling a water restoration expert is ideal because they have the necessary tools, like industrial-size fans, that can dry up water quickly.

Sadly, water is the most likely reason that you might have to renovate. Seeking professional help and having the right home and flood insurance can make taking care of the problem easier.
